Which best describes how our understanding of DNA and inherited traits has changed over time

Biology
1 answer:
MAVERICK [17]3 years ago
4 0
<h3><u>Answer;</u></h3>

It was developed by many scientists over many decades.

<h3><u> Explanation;</u></h3>
  • DNA is a type of nucleic acid that contains two long, twisted strands, known as double helix, that contain complementary genetic information.
  • A gene is a segment of DNA that is passed down from parents to children and confers a trait to the offspring.
  • The traits an organism displays are ultimately determined by the genes it inherited from its parents, known as genotype.
  • Our understanding of DNA and inherited traits has changed over time since it has been continuously developed by many scientists over may decades.

What is the role of the protein pumps?
levacccp [35]

Answer:

Pumps, also called transporters, are transmembrane proteins that actively move ions and/or solutes against a concentration or electrochemical gradient across biological membranes. One moves with the concentration gradient (high to low) which powers the movement of the other against the gradient (low to high).
